The verdict

Armstrong Services DBA Legend Oaks Northwest Houston runs at 106% of its industry's injury rate - about level with the typical Skilled nursing facilities workplace, earning a grade C.

Armstrong Services DBA Legend Oaks Northwest Houston: 6.9 TCR = 106% of Skilled nursing facilities BLS 6.5 · 3y Form 300A (see methodology below)

Armstrong Services DBA Legend Oaks Northwest Houston injury rate improved

Armstrong Services DBA Legend Oaks Northwest Houston's TCR fell 1.9 from 7.2 in 2016 to 5.3 in 2018. Peak filing year was 2017 at 8.1 TCR. In 2018, DART was 0.46× this establishment's average TCR (severity share of cases).

2016=7.2 · 2017=8.1 · 2018=5.3

Year-by-Year Safety Data

Year TCR DART Injuries Illnesses Fatalities
2018 5.3 3.2 5 0 0
2017 8.1 3.0 6 2 0
2016 7.2 2.9 5 0 0
